1. The Fundamentals of Quantum Computing
At its heart, quantum computing utilizes the principles of quantum mechanics, such as superimposition and interconnection, to carry out complicated calculations at previously unthinkable speeds. Unlike classical computers that process data in binary bits (0 or 1), quantum computers use quantum bits or qubits, which can exist in multiple states simultaneously.
